Tasting Notes

Caramel · Red Apple · Cinnamon Roll · Honeydew Melon · Lemon Bar

It's not every day a coffee farm is also an UNESCO World Heritage Site. At Hacienda La Amistad, over 90% of their sprawling 4,000 acres is a protected biological corridor. On the other 10% is a variety of farming, including coffee on about 300 acres, where they produce wonderfully consistent coffee emblematic of the quality Costa Rica has offered for decades. This is a sweet coffee from all angles - red apples, caramel, and cinnamon roll. 

The Farm

One of the most storied and unique farms in the America's, Finca La Amistad has been growing for over 100 years. Roberto Montero leads a fully organic, Smithsonian Bird Friendly, is fully organic, located within a UNESCO World Heritage Site of one of the largest forest reserves in Central America... what more could you ask for? Oh, they are also entirely hydroelectric and built on a closed-loop composting system. If there was a model for large-scale coffee farmers, this is it.
